Dominant Donegal defeat Tyrone in All-Ireland series

written by Staff Writer May 25, 2024
FacebookTweetLinkedInPrint

Donegal 0-21 v 0-14 Tyrone

Donegal got their All Ireland series campaign off to a brilliant start with a win over local rivals Tyrone in Ballybofey tonight.

Both sides showed plenty of attacking intent in an energetic first half, as Tyrone looked to avenge their Ulster Championship semi-final defeat.

Donegal were able to edge a point ahead at the half time break however, several scores from Oisin Gallen upfront the highlight.

In the second half Donegal were then able to use the wind to their advantage, stringing off a number of scores in quick succession that was capped off with a brilliant Ciaran Thompson score to take their lead to five points.

Tyrone would battle back briefly to bring the gap down to three, but down the stretch Donegal would put their foot to the floor to stamp their authority on the tie.

Besting Tyrone by six scores to one in the last fifteen minutes of play, Jim McGuinness’ men planted Donegal’s flag firmly in the ground as All Ireland contenders with this performance.
